The ENDRESS+HAUSER temperature transmitter that offers unsurpassed reliability, accuracy, and long-term stability in critical processes across various industries. With its configurable design, it can transfer digital converted signals from RTD and TC sensors, as well as resistance and voltage signals using PROFIBUS PA communication. It provides high measurement point availability through sensor monitoring functions and diagnostics information according to NAMUR NE 107. It ensures high accuracy through sensor-transmitter matching, making it ideal for applications that require precise temperature measurement and control. Its installation options include flat-face terminal head as per DIN EN 50446 and optional installation in field housings for use in Ex d areas.
